Super 25 High School Football Teams Face Crucial Week 10 Matches
The Illinois high school football landscape continues to unfold with several top-ranked teams facing must-win matches in Week 10.
At the top of the heap is Mount Carmel, which remains undefeated at 9-0 after a convincing 57-0 win over Jefferson. Brother Rice also stays on track with a 9-1 record, beating Jefferson 56-20 to further solidify its position. Meanwhile, Nazareth, Glenbard West, and Fremd round out the top five with impressive victories.
As for the teams outside the top 10, Lincoln-Way East moves into the rankings after a dominant 45-0 win over Stevenson. On the other side of the spectrum, York drops to No. 20 after losing to Lyons in Week 9. The Hersey and Bradley-Bourbonnais also see action, with Hersey securing an easy 56-0 victory against Payton.
In terms of upsets, St. Francis fell short this week as it lost its game to Morgan Park. However, the loss did not deter Morris from making a statement in its matchup against Woodstock, emerging victorious 54-7.
As we head into Week 11, several key matchups will determine the fate of these high school football teams. With the season heating up, teams are expected to give it their all as they fight for a championship title.
